ABB UFC760BE142 (3BHE004573R0142) – Drive Control Interface Board
The ABB UFC760BE142 (3BHE004573R0142) is an advanced drive control interface board developed for ABB industrial drive and power electronics systems. It is responsible for managing control signal flow, coordinating communication between subsystems, and supporting precise operational control. Designed for reliability and long-term stability, this module is well suited for high-demand industrial applications.
System Function & Control Logic
Within an ABB drive architecture, the UFC760BE142 operates as a core control interface layer. It receives control commands from the main controller, processes feedback signals from the drive system, and ensures synchronized communication with power modules and monitoring circuits. This role is essential for maintaining accurate drive response and stable system behavior.

Installation & Maintenance
Installation Guidelines
Install the board following ABB-approved mechanical and electrical procedures.
Observe proper ESD protection during handling.
Confirm correct connector alignment and secure mounting.
Verify compatibility with the target drive system before power-up.
Maintenance Recommendations
Periodically inspect the board for signs of overheating or connector wear.
Keep the drive enclosure clean to support effective thermal management.
Monitor system diagnostics for control-related alarms.
Replace the board if persistent control faults occur.
